引言
Ubuntu作为一款基于Linux的开源操作系统,以其稳定性、安全性以及丰富的软件资源而受到广大用户的喜爱。在Ubuntu系统中,命令行界面是进行系统管理和日常操作的重要工具。为了帮助用户快速掌握和高效使用Ubuntu命令,以下将详细介绍Ubuntu系统中的常用命令。
一、文件和目录管理
1. 列出目录内容
ls
:列出当前目录下的文件和目录。ls -l
:以详细列表形式显示文件和目录信息(包含权限、所有者、大小等)。ls -a
:显示所有文件,包括隐藏文件(以.开头的文件)。ls -lh
:以易读格式显示文件大小(自动转换为KB/MB/GB单位)。
2. 改变目录
cd /path/to/directory
:进入指定绝对路径目录。cd ~/Documents
:进入当前用户的家目录下的Documents目录。
3. 创建目录
mkdir 目录名
:创建一个新目录。
4. 删除目录
rmdir 空目录名
:删除一个空目录。rm -rf 非空目录名
:强制删除一个非空目录及其所有内容。
5. 复制文件或目录
cp 源文件 目标文件
:复制文件或目录。cp -r 源目录 目标目录
:递归复制目录及其内容。
6. 移动或重命名文件或目录
mv 源文件 目标文件
:移动或重命名文件或目录。
7. 删除文件或目录
rm 文件名
:删除单个或多个文件。rm -rf 非空目录名
:强制删除一个非空目录及其所有内容。
二、系统管理
1. 查看系统信息
uname -r
:显示正在使用的内核版本。lsb_release -a
:显示Ubuntu版本信息。lscpu
:显示CPU信息。free -m
:显示内存信息。df -h
:显示已加载的文件系统信息。du -sh 文件名
:估算文件或目录的磁盘使用空间。
2. 网络管理
ping 网址
:测试网络连接。ifconfig
:显示或配置网络接口。
3. 用户管理
useradd 用户名
:创建一个新的用户。groupadd 组名
:创建一个新的组。passwd 用户名
:为用户设置或修改密码。userdel 用户名
:删除用户。
4. 权限管理
chmod 权限 文件名
:改变文件的权限。chown 用户:组 文件名
:改变文件的所有者和所属组。
三、文本处理
1. 查看文件内容
cat 文件名
:查看文件内容。more 文件名
:分页查看文件内容。less 文件名
:分页查看文件内容。
2. 搜索文本
grep 关键词 文件名
:搜索文本,并打印匹配行。
3. 文本编辑
vi 文件名
:使用vi编辑器编辑文件。
四、其他常用命令
1. 时间管理
date
:显示或设置系统时间与日期。
2. 系统关机
shutdown -h now
:立即关机。shutdown -r now
:立即重启。
3. 软件包管理
sudo apt-get install <packagename>
:安装软件包。sudo apt-get upgrade
:升级已安装的软件包。
通过以上命令速查手册,用户可以快速掌握Ubuntu系统中的常用命令,提高工作效率。在学习和使用过程中,请结合实际情况进行实践和总结。